繁体   English   中英

在 MongoDB 和 JavaScript 中备份多个 Collections

[英]Backup Multiple Collections in MongoDB with JavaScript

我正在尝试使用 javascript 备份多个 collections 但它似乎不起作用。 我曾尝试在不同的地方添加和删除分号,但仍然无法正常工作。

这是我想要实现的代码。

 var colls = ["inventory","inventoryA","inventoryC"];

 for(var i = 0; i < colls.length; i++)
  {
   mongodump --db Demo --collection colls.values();
 }

我尝试通过转到 mongodump 目录来执行 javascript 文件:

C:\Program Files\MongoDB\Server\4.0\bin>mongo multipllecollection.js MongoDB shell version v4.0.1 connecting to: mongodb://127.0.0.1:27017 MongoDB server version: 4.0.1 2020-04-16T13:11 :45.484+0800 E QUERY [js] SyntaxError: missing; 之前声明@multipllecollection.js:5:12 加载失败:multipllecollection.js

我在哪里 go 错了? 谢谢

我想我会使用 excludeCollection() 或 excludeCollectionsWithPrefix,但是当有这么多 collections 时会很乏味。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M